What the BME280 does
The BME280 is a combined digital humidity, pressure, and temperature sensor housed in a compact 2.5 mm x 2.5 mm metal lid LGA package. It features a supply voltage range of 1.71 V to 3.6 V, current consumption as low as 0.1 µA in sleep mode, and a humidity response time of 1 second. The device offers an accuracy tolerance of ±3% for relative humidity and an RMS noise of 0.2 Pa for pressure measurements. Engineers typically use this component for context awareness, fitness monitoring, home automation control, indoor navigation, and weather forecasting in battery-driven devices like handsets, watches, and GPS units.
Datasheet parameters
| Parameter | Min | Typ | Max | Conditions | Source |
|---|---|---|---|---|---|
| quiescent current | — | 2.8 µA | 4.2 µA | 1 Hz forced mode, pressure and temperature, lowest power; Pressure parameter specification | Bosch datasheet, p. 10 — Table 3: Pressure parameter specification |
| supply voltage range | 1.71 V | 1.8 V | 3.6 V | ripple max. 50 mVpp; Electrical parameter specification | Bosch datasheet, p. 8 — Table 1: Electrical parameter specification |
| abs max voltage (abs max) | -300 mV | — | 4.25 V | VDDand VDDIOpin | Bosch datasheet, p. 13 — Table 5: Absolute maximum ratings |
| operating temperature | -40 °C | 25 °C | 85 °C | operational; Pressure parameter specification | Bosch datasheet, p. 10 — Table 3: Pressure parameter specification |
| standby current | — | 100 nA | 300 nA | Electrical parameter specification | Bosch datasheet, p. 8 — Table 1: Electrical parameter specification |
